This would be a great feature request for your specific purposes.  I checked and to my surprise this feature is not yet submitted as a new idea, so please do submit one.

Formatting was by design originally hidden from Docs, given the focus on content over format.  For most use cases I think this is a good thing, and as a cloud-based collaborative editor it has other advantages, even if formatting isn't its strong suit.
